The global fiber optic connectivity market size is expected to stand at USD 8.25 Bn in 2026 and is projected to reach USD 17.20 Bn by 2033, expanding at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 11.5% from 2026 to 2033. The global fiber optic connectivity market represents a critical infrastructure segment that forms the backbone of modern digital communications and data transmission networks worldwide. Fiber optic technology utilizes thin strands of glass or plastic fibers to transmit data through light signals, offering superior bandwidth capacity, faster transmission speeds, and enhanced reliability compared to traditional copper-based connectivity solutions.
This market encompasses a comprehensive range of products including fiber optic cables, connectors, transceivers, switches, and related networking equipment that enable high-speed data transmission across various applications. The proliferation of cloud computing, Internet of Things (IoT) devices, 5G network deployments, and increasing demand for high-definition video streaming services has significantly accelerated the adoption of fiber optic connectivity solutions across telecommunications, enterprise networks, data centers, and residential broadband applications.
Market Dynamics
The global fiber optic connectivity market is primarily driven by the exponential growth in data traffic and bandwidth requirements across various industries, fueled by the widespread adoption of cloud-based services, video conferencing platforms, streaming applications, and IoT devices that demand high-speed, reliable connectivity solutions. The accelerated deployment of 5G networks worldwide serves as a significant growth catalyst, as telecommunications providers require extensive fiber optic infrastructure to support the backhaul and fronthaul requirements of 5G base stations and small cells. Additionally, the increasing digitalization of businesses, remote work trends, and growing investments in smart city initiatives are propelling demand for robust fiber optic networks.
However, the market faces notable restraints including high initial installation costs and infrastructure deployment expenses, which can be particularly challenging for developing regions with limited financial resources. The complexity of fiber optic network installation, requiring specialized technical expertise and equipment, presents additional barriers to rapid market expansion. Furthermore, the fragility of fiber optic cables and potential signal loss over long distances without proper amplification can pose technical challenges.
